Council authorizes gas-hedging contracts for summer 2030 and winter 2030–31

Eden Plus City Council · July 13, 2026

Council authorized city staff to hedge 25% of expected gas use for summer 2030 at up to $3.10 per decatherm and 25% for winter 2030–31 at up to $5.65 per decatherm, and to extend agreements needed to execute contracts; the motion passed by voice vote.

During the public works report, council members considered a proposed gas-hedging strategy designed to lock in prices for a portion of the city's future gas needs.

A council member proposed authorizing hedges for 25% of expected gas use for summer 2030 at $3.10 per decatherm or better and for 25% of expected use for winter 2030–31 at $5.65 per decatherm or better, and to extend agreements with the city’s carrier as needed. Council Member Sorkin seconded the motion. After discussion, the council approved the motion by voice vote.

Council did not record a roll-call tally in the transcript; the meeting record shows a voice vote and the chair declared the motion passed.
